Obama forgets the Coast Guard


Afghanistan - Obama needed a little help from the troops in Afghanistan as he thanked the military branches for their work but forgot to mention the Coast Guard. “I think we’ve got every service here tonight,” Obama said. He then called on the branches as their members cheered: “We’ve got Army. We’ve got Navy. We’ve got Air Force. I think we may have a few Marines around, too.” Moving to his remarks, Obama said, “Now, here in Afghanistan …” Then, someone in the crowd shouted out, “Coast Guard!” “Coast Guard?” Obama repeated. “Is that what I heard?” ...More

Military bases worldwide to offer morning-after pill


WASHINGTON - The Pentagon for the first time will require military bases worldwide to offer emergency contraception or the so-called morning-after pill, a military spokeswoman said Thursday. Gates to announce review of military gay ban (AP)

AP - Defense Secretary Robert Gates is tapping two seasoned Pentagon officials to lead the military's first in-depth study on allowing openly gay service members, promising to try to spare more troops from being dismissed in the meantime.

China suspends military exchanges with US

BEIJING (AP) -- China suspended military exchanges with the United States, threatened unprecedented sanctions against American defense companies and warned Saturday that cooperation would suffer after Washington announced $6.4 billion in planned arms sales to Taiwan---...More
